How many copies has Total War: PHARAOH sold on Steam?

With 5,070 Steam reviews and a 64% positive rating, we estimate Total War: PHARAOH has sold between 101,400 and 304,200 copies, with a best estimate of 147,030.

This is based on the Boxleiter method, which uses the observation that roughly 1 in every 20 to 60 buyers leaves a Steam review. For the midpoint we do not assume a universal 30x value; we use a calibrated multiplier of x29 that adjusts for the title's age, price tier, genre, and review profile.

What percentage does Steam take from Total War: PHARAOH?

Steam uses a tiered revenue sharing model that reduces the platform's cut as a game earns more:

  • First $10 million: 30% to Steam, 70% to developer
  • $10M to $50M: 25% to Steam, 75% to developer
  • Above $50M: 20% to Steam, 80% to developer

For Total War: PHARAOH, with an estimated gross revenue of $5,585,670, this results in an effective rate of 30.0%. Steam keeps approximately $1,675,701 and CREATIVE ASSEMBLY receives $3,909,969.

How accurate are these revenue estimates for Total War: PHARAOH?

These estimates use the Boxleiter method, a widely-used industry approach that estimates game sales from the number of Steam reviews.

Factors that affect accuracy:

  • Review-to-purchase ratio varies by genre
  • Discount history - games with frequent deep sales may have higher ratios
  • Regional pricing - different prices in different markets are not captured
  • Refunds - Steam's return policy means some counted sales were refunded
  • Bundled sales - keys sold through third-party bundles may not generate reviews

We provide a confidence range ($3,852,186 to $11,556,558) to reflect this uncertainty. For the best estimate we combine the Boxleiter range with a calibrated midpoint (x29) and a calibrated ASP of $38.
